  • I recently purchased songs and some of them did not download to my computer but just a few seconds, all the song did not download, while other songs were perfectly fine.  How do I get the full songs downloaded now?

    Some of my recently purchased songs did not fully download while other songs did.  Has anyone else had a problem like this?  Did I do something wrong?  I purchased all the same way, but only received a parcel song on about half of my purchases.  Help.....

    Assuming you are in a region where you are allowed to redownload your past music purchases, delete the broken tracks from your iTunes library, close and then reopen iTunes, go to the iTunes Store home page, click the Purchased link from the Quick Links section in the right-hand column, then select Music and Not on this computer. You should find download links for your tracks there.
    While downloading select Downloads in the left-hand column and make sure Allow Simultaneous Downloads is unticked.
    If the problem persists, or that facility is not yet available in your region, contact the iTunes Store support staff through the report a problem links in your account history, or via Contact Support.

  • I have recently purchased an Ipod with 2430 tunes stored on it and I wish to transfer these tunes to Itunes and then upload them to another Ipod.  How do I do this please?

    I have recently purchased an Ipod with 2430 tunes stored on it and I wish to transfer these tunes to I tunes and then upload them to another Ipod I own.  In plain speak how do I do this please?

    On-The-Go Playlists, created on your iPod Classic, are added to your iTunes Library when you Sync the iPod to the same iTunes Library that you have been using up to now.
    But note that On-The-Go Playlists, saved on the Classic, are named as New Playlist 1, New Playlist 2, etc. and are listed at the end of the Playlists. When you Sync your iPod with its iTunes Library, those saved Playlists are transferred to the Library, renamed as On-The-Go X (where X is the next available number) and then added back to your iPod with the new name. They will also be in correct alphabetical order, so they will be in the Playlists list under O for On-The-Go.
    If you also have an On-The-Go Playlist on the iPod (which has not been saved), that too will be uploaded to iTunes in the same manner.
    For some unknown reason, you will also probably see one extra, but empty, Playlist created in iTunes. This is a bug, which may get fixed one day! Until then, you simply have to delete in in iTunes.

  • HT1325 Problems with purchased songs and new computers

    I have a new computer; my first mac. I am an apple convert, previously owning a toshiba. Some of the songs from an album I purchased through itunes will not play. What do I do? They have an ! with a circle around it next to them. I do not have a hardcopy or backup to revert back to. I just want to know how to be able to play these songs and listen to them as I have purchased the right to do so.

    Depending upon what country that you are in (music can't be redownloaded in all countries) then you might be able to redownoad it via the Purchased link under Quicklinks on the right-hand side of the iTunes store homepage.
    If it shows there but doesn't have the cloud symbol against it then try deleting it from the Music part of your library (where you are getting the exclamation mark) and it should then get the cloud symbol in Purchased for redownloading.
    If music shows there but not that album then is it still in your country's store ? If it is then check to see if it's hidden : http://support.apple.com/kb/HT4919
    If you aren't in a country where music can be redownloaded or if it'sno longer in your country's store then you won't be able to redownload it.
    But you should be keeping and maintaining a backup copy of all of your downloads, an item can be removed from the store at any time - you are only guaranteed one download of each item.

  • I purchase songs and only a portion of the song was down loaded?

    HELP - I purchase songs and only a portion of the song was down loaded?

    Other people have been having similar problems with songs over a number of days, I assume that there has been a problem with Apple's servers.
    Depending upon what country that you are in (music can't be re-downloaded in all countries) then try deleting the incomplete tracks from your iTunes library and redownload them via the Purchased link under Quick Links on the right-hand side of the iTunes store home page on your computer's iTunes : re-downloading.
    If you aren't in a country where you can re-download music or if they re-downloads in the same state then try the 'report a problem' link from your purchase history : log into your account on your computer's iTunes via Store > View My Account and you should then see a Purchase History section with a 'see all' link to the right of it ; click on that and you should see a list of your purchases ; find those songs and use the 'Report a Problem' link.
